IT is observed that it thunders most when the Wind blows from the South, and least when it blows from the East. The great Principle of Thunder is Sulphur, as is evident from the Smell it leaves behind it; but in order to occasion such an Explosion, there must be other Ingredients mixed therewith, especially Nitre, of which the Air is always full, besides other Things, of which it is impossible to give any Account. The Tracts of this Sort of Matter fly about in the Air, and are as it were Lines of Gunpowder, and as in the firing of that Powder, the Fire begins at one End, and pursuing its Aliment proceeds to the other Extremity, and so the whole Mass of Powder is fired; we may from thence account for the Phaenomenon of Thunder. For in like Manner those inflamed Tracts which are suspended in the Air, flash from a Flame that runs from one Extreme to the other, wherever the Vein of Nourishment leads it. Hence those Rays of Thunder, which seem to be brandished through the Air, and sometimes to be split in two or more Tracts, and sometimes to return back, at other Times to be projected in Lines that are joined by various Angles, and this only because the Flame meets with Tracts lying in various Situations that cohere one with another. Therefore Thunder seems now to run horizontally, now from above downwards, now upwards from the Earth, for if the Matter of Thunder pressing out of the Earth is enflamed near the Ground, the Flame darting upwards, the Thunder will seem to be projected out of the Earth. If the same Tract be set on Fire at its upper end, the Flame will move downwards, and the Thunder will seem to descend out of the Sky.

HENCE we easily understand how it comes to thunder oftener in one Place than another, but most frequently in those where the Soil produces odoriferous Herbs, and abounds with Sulphur, and where the People are much exposed to the extreme Heat of the Sun. Thunder is less frequent in Places where there are few odoriferous Herbs, very little Sulphur, or where the Climate is watery and moist. For Instance, it thunders very much in Italy and Sicily, and very rarely in Egypt, and the adjacent Countries. If it be demanded how it comes to thunder in the midst of the Ocean? The Answer is easy, because from the Bottom of the Ocean vast Tracts of sulphureous Matter are cast up through the Waters; as it happens to spring Waters in several Places, the Streams of which will take Fire from a lighted Candle. For sulphureous Exhalations bursting out together with the Waters, the fulmineous Matter in the Air is set on Fire when it meets with Exhalations or Vapours with which it can excite a vehement Effervescence. It is very clear from this Account, that the Clouds mentioned at the Top of the twenty-eighth Page are thunder Clouds, or Clouds big with the Materials of Thunder.

XIX.

If two such Clouds arise, one on either Hand, it is Time to make haste to shelter.

AS this Observation is of the same Nature with the former, we shall continue our Remarks. The Reason why it seldom thunders in Winter is, because the exterior Parts of the Earth are so contracted by the cold Snow and Ice, that Sulphur cannot perspire in any great Quantities, but as soon as the Earth begins to be opened by the Sun in the Spring, something expires in the Month of April which takes Fire. But by the greater Heat of the Sun penetrating deeper into the Earth, the Cortex is more opened in May, and now there is a more copious Expiration of the fulminating Matter, and whatever was collected and shut up in Winter, is now released and snatched up in the Air, and thence proceeds the most frequent Thunders in the Month of May, and chiefly when a very hot Day or two has gone before. A less Quantity of the same Matter remains in the upper Cortex of the Earth for the Month of June, but in the mean Time a Stock arises out of the deeper Bowels of the Earth, which is attenuated and prepared, so that by the very fervent Heat of July it is elevated, as it were in heaps, and set on Fire. Hence Thunder is as frequent in July as in May. And the Heat decreasing in the succeeding Months, the Exhalation of the fulminating Matter out of the Earth is more sparing, and thence, also, the thunder is less frequent, till in October, and the other winter months, the earth is bound up with us, and hardly expires any more. Hence we see why it very seldom thunders when the northerly winds blow; for these winds constringe the earth with their cold, and so hinder the fulminating matter from bursting forth; and when they are burst forth and floating in the air, they hinder their effervency. But on the contrary, when the warm and moist south winds blow, which open every thing, the earth likewise is opened, and abundance of fulminating matter is expired and ascends on high, which is there easily inflamed.

AS the flame runs very swiftly, it seems to carry along with it particles, which it could not so easily set on fire, and when any of these particles are drawn together, and heated to a certain degree, they at last take fire, with a sudden and great explosion, and thereby produce what we call a thunder Clap. Now, though this be only a single sound, yet it is often heard in the form of a great murmuring noise of a long continuance; sometimes for thirty or forty seconds, because of its various repercussions by the clouds and terrestrial obstacles. Hence it is, that in vales, which are surrounded by mountains of a different Height, there is a terrible and long continued Bellowing of thunder Claps. Whereas for one Explosion it has been observed that there is but one Clap. Yet however if the Flame set Fire to two, three, or more fulmineous Tracts, each of them at last will end in a Clap, and thus several Sounds may be heard together, or quickly succeeding one another.

XX.

If you see a Cloud rise against the Wind or side Wind, when that Cloud comes up to you, the Wind will blow the same Way that the Cloud came. And the same Rule holds of a clear Place, when all the Sky is equally thick, except one clear Edge.

THIS seems to arise from hence, that Wind being nothing more than Air in motion, the Effects of it first discover themselves above, and actually drive such Clouds before them. This was long ago observed by Pliny. When Clouds, says he, float about in a serene Sky, from whatever Quarter they come, you may expect Winds. If they are collected together in one Place, they will be dispersed by the approach of the Sun. If these Clouds come from the North East, they denote Winds; if from the South great Rains. But let them come from what Quarter they will, if you see them driving thus about Sunset, they are sure signs of an approaching Tempest.

IF the Clouds look dusky, or of a tarnish silver Colour, and move very slowly, it is a Sign of Hail. But to speak more plainly, those very Clouds are laden with Hail, which if there be a Mixture of Blue in the Clouds will be small, but if very yellow, large. Small scattering Clouds that fly very high, especially, from the South West, denote Whirlwinds. The shooting of fallen Stars through them, is a Sign of Thunder. We meet with many Observations of this sort in our old Writers on Husbandry, and we have abundance of Proverbs relating to this Subject which are worth observing, and the rather, because most of them are not peculiar to our Language only, but common to us with many of our Neighbours. It is the Remark of Lord Bacon, and a very judicious Remark too, that Proverbs are the Philosophy of the common People, that is to say, they are trite Remarks founded in Truth, and fitted for Memory. I must confess that there are some of them that seem either false, or of no great Consequence, but then I am apt to suspect, that by various Accidents we have lost their true Meaning, or else, that in length of Time, they have been altered and corrupted, till they have little or no meaning at all.

I cannot help taking Notice in Regard to the Rule before us, that Captain Dampier tells us in the East-Indies, they have always Notice of a Tuffoon by the Skies being first clear and calm, and then a small white Cloud hanging precisely in the Point from whence the Storm comes, where he observes that it remains sometimes twelve Hours or more, and adds, that as soon as it begins to move, the Wind presently follows it. When Sir John Bury, who died an English Admiral, had the Command of a small Frigate in the West-Indies, he escaped a Hurricane in the Leward Islands by taking the Advice of a poor Negro, who shewed him a small white Cloud at a Distance, and assured him that when it came to the Zenith, the Hurricane would infallibly begin, as indeed it did.

XXI.

Sudden Rains never last long: But when the Air grows thick by Degrees, and the Sun, Moon, and Stars shine dimmer and dimmer, then it is like to rain six Hours usually.

RAIN is, properly speaking, a Multitude of small watery Drops, falling from the upper Air at different Seasons. When the upper Regions become cold of a sudden, the watery Clouds are condensed and fall in hasty Showers. It is observed that mountainous Countries have most Rain, and the Reason seems to be the Winds driving the Clouds against the Rocks and Hills, and thereby compressing them in such a Manner, that they are immediately dissolved, and fall as it were at once. This is the Reason that in Lancashire there falls twice as much Rain as in Essex, and it is probably from the same Cause, that in the Ocean, over-against the mountainous Coast of Guinea, showers sometimes fall as it were by Pailfuls.

THIS Observation of our Shepherd is very just and reasonable, and I dare say will hardly ever fail such as observe it. The Dimness of the Stars and other heavenly Bodies, is one of the surest Signs of very rainy Weather. It is likewise to be observed that when the Stars look bigger than usual, and are pale and dull and without Rays, this undoubtedly indicates that the Clouds are condensing into Rain, which will very soon fall; and it has been observed that when the Air grows thick by Degrees, and the Light of the Sun lessens so as not to be discerned at all, and again when the Moon or Stars have the same Appearances, a continued Rain for at least six Hours is sure to follow.

TO be the better informed in such Cases, it is best to have Recourse to a variety of Signs, for it is not only the Clouds and Sky, or the Sun, Moon, and Stars, that gives us previous Notice of rainy Weather, but almost every Thing in the Creation, and Vegetables particularly. As for Instance, the Pimpernel, which is a very common flower, shuts itself up extremely close against rainy Weather. In like manner the Trefoil swells in the Stalk against Rain, so that it stands up very stiff, but the Leaves droop and hang down. Even the most solid Bodies are affected by this Change of the Atmosphere, for Stones seem to sweat, and Wood swells, the Air driving the moist Particles with which it is filled into the Pores of dry Wood especially, makes it swell prodigiously, and this is the Reason the Doors and Windows are hard to shut in rainy Weather.

THIS is so true, that there has been a Method found of dividing Mill-stones by the mere Force of the Air, which is done in this Manner. They divide a Block of this kind of Stone as big as a large rolling Stone, into as many Parts as they design to make Millstones, and in the Circles where this Block is to be divided, they pierce several Holes, which they fill with allow Wood dried in an Oven, and expose the Stone to the Air, in moist Weather; when the Wood swells to such a Degree as to split the Stone as effectually, as if it was by iron Wedges driven by Sledge-Hammers. This curious and extraordinary Method of dividing Mill-stones is related by the famous Mr. Ozanam of his own Knowledge.

XXII.

If it begin to Rain from the South, with a high Wind for two or three Hours, and the Wind falls, but the Rain continues, it is like to rain twelve Hours or more, and does usually rain till a strong North Wind clears the Air. These long Rains seldom hold above twelve Hours, or happen above once a Year.

THIS depends entirely upon Observation, and Experience shews us that whenever the Wind falls, Rain follows. It has been likewise observed, that when the Wind changes often there fall heavy Rains. All these Alterations in the Atmosphere, are less observed by Men than by Animals, for two Reasons. The first is, that we live much within Doors, by which they are less obvious to us, and it is for this Reason that the Husbandman, Seamen, Fishermen, but above all Shepherds, who are more in the open Air than other Men, are better acquainted with, and more able to distinguish and judge of the Signs of the Alteration of the Weather, than those who live altogether within Doors, or go out but seldom. Another Reason is our having so many Things to mind, which takes off our Thoughts, and renders us less attentive to the Signals which would give up Notice of such Alterations. It is for this Reason that we ought to serve ourselves of that Sort of Instinct which Nature has given to other Animals, and which as it is a Gift of Nature, is in a Manner infallible.

THUS if small Birds prune themselves and duck and make a shew of washing. If Crows make a great Noise in the Evening, if Geese gaggle more than usual, these are all Signs of Rain, because these Animals love wet Weather, and rejoice at the approach of it. On the other Hand, if Oxen lie on their Right Sides, look towards the South, and lick their Hoofs, if Cows look up in the Air, and snuff it, if Asses bray violently, and if Cocks crow at unusual Hours, but especially when a Hen and Chickens crowd into the House, these are sure Signs of Rain.

INSECTS also are very sensible of such Changes of Weather. Frogs croak more than ordinary, Worms creep out of the Ground, Moles throw up more Earth than usual, because such Weather is more agreeable to them; Hornets, Wasps, and Gnats, sting more frequently against wet Weather than in fair. Spiders are restless and uneasy, and frequently drop from the Wall, the humid Air getting into their Webs and making them heavy. But the surest and most certain Sign is taken from Bees, which are more incommoded by Rain than almost any other Creatures, and therefore, as soon as the Air begins to grow heavy, and the Vapours to condense, they will not fly from their Hives, but either remain in them all Day, or else fly but to a small Distance.

XXIII.

If it begins to rain an Hour or two before Sun-rising, it is like to be fair before Noon, and so continue that Day, but if the Rain begin an Hour or two after Sun-rising, it is like to Rain all that Day, except the Rainbow be seen before it rains.

THIS is a short, clear, and easy Observation, and therefore I shall not dwell long upon it, but rather entertain the Reader with a few Observations on the Rainbow. Whenever it appears, things are thus circumstanced. The Spectator has the Sun behind him, and Clouds with the Bow in them before him. Sometimes there are two and even three Bows seen, but this is very rare. The Colours in the Bow are ranged in this Order, viz. Violet, Purple, Blue, Green, Yellow, Orange, Red. After a long Drought the Bow is a certain Sign of Rain, if after much Wet fair Weather. If the Green be large and bright it is a Sign of Rain, but if the Red be the strongest Colour, then it denotes Wind and Rain together. If the Bow breaks up all at once there will follow serene and settled Weather. If the Bow be seen in the Morning small Rain will follow. If at Noon, settled and heavy Rains; if at Night, fair Weather. The Appearance of two or three Rainbows shews fair Weather for the present, but settled and heavy Rains in two or three Days' Time.

LUNAR Rainbows are sometimes, but very seldom seen, they are extremely beautiful, but much less than those that appear in the Day time, and a yellow, or rather a straw Colour prevails most. As they happen so seldom, they cannot well be reckoned amongst the Signs of Weather. But now, after speaking of so many different Methods of judging when rainy Weather will be of a short or long Continuance: Give me leave to describe two or three Instruments easily made, which will shew the Alterations of the Weather certainly, constantly, and early enough for most Uses.

THERE were some Years ago a Sort of Toys sold, with a Man and a Woman so fixed before the Door of a House, that at the Approach of wet Weather the Woman entered it, and when the Weather grew fair the Man. This was done by the Help of a Bit of Catgut, which shrinks in wet Weather, and stretches again when it is fair. This appears better by a Line and Plummet, especially if the Line be made of good Whipcord, that is well dried, for then if it be hung against a Wainscot, and a Line drawn under it exactly where the Plummet reaches, in very moderate Weather it will be found to rise above it before Rain, and to sink below when the Weather is like to become fair; but the best Instrument of all is a good Pair of Scales, in one of which let there be a brass Weight of a Pound, and in the other a Pound of Salt, or of Salt-Petre well dried, a Stand being placed under the Scale, so as to hinder its falling too low. When it is inclined to rain the Salt will swell, and sink the Scale, when the Weather is growing fair, the brass Weight will regain its Ascendancy.
